  • Patent number: 11713833
    Abstract: A system and method for securely cradling a subsea pipeline is claimed that lands on one side of the pipeline, is embedded into the sea floor, reaches under the pipeline, positions the cradling structure, and then lifts the pipeline. The system typically comprises a gravity driven pile based device, comprising a pile tower, a roller carriage assembly, and a jacking assembly that engages the roller carriage assembly and pile tower rails.

  • Patent number: 11454343
    Abstract: In embodiments, a hot tap clamping system comprises a clamp which fits over and secures against a pipe, an actuator interface, an actuator operatively in communication with clamp, and a hot tap assembly. In a further embodiment, a system for sealing a flowline with a metal seal after hot tapping comprises a sealer, a hot tap drill/plug running tool, and a metal seal plug which is typically configured for use in sealing a flowline, e.g. a pipe, with a metal seal after hot tapping where the metal plug seal is inserted into the pipe and engages with and seals as a hot tap.
